Audit Bureau of Circulations becomes Alliance for Audited Media

The New York-based Audit Bureau of Circulations has rebranded itself as the Alliance for Audited Media. According to the organization, the new brand is intended to more accurately portray its evolving position in media verification across multiple platforms including print, mobile devices, websites and social media services. The change also reflects its acquisition earlier this year of Certified Audit of Circulations. The new brand also includes a new logo and redesigned US and Canadian websites. "The ABC brand has served our organization and our industry well for nearly 100 years, but this represents much more than a name change," said Michael Lavery, president and managing director of the Alliance for Audited Media. "With advancements in the media industry and the progress our organization has made in developing new digital audit services and cross-media expertise, we felt it was time to refresh our brand to better reflect our strategic role in the new world of media."
